Fiji born, Isi Naisarani scored a spectacular try for the Brumbies last night but it was not enough as the Chiefs thumped the Australians 38‑26 in a pre-season Super Rugby match on the Sunshine Coast last night.
The former Ratu Kadavulevu School student showed some lightning speed when he found some space.
Naisarani picked up a loose ball near halfway and dashed clear like a thoroughbred for an electric second‑half try.
Australian Super Rugby teams lost all 26 games to Kiwi opponents last year, and the Chiefs were swarming all over the Brumbies in the first half with ball control proving a real problem for the Brumbies.
According to Stuff.co, even the Brumbies' website couldn't cope with the Kiwi onslaught, crashing in the first half.
Chiefs halfback Brad Weber staked a claim for the No 9 jersey following Tawera Kerr‑Barlow's French defection with a first‑half hat‑trick that set up their 33‑7 lead just after halftime.
In two pre-season matches today, the Hurricanes will face the Blues at 4pm in Auckland while the Crusaders will take on the Highlanders at 5pm in Otago.
Players like David Havili, Seta Tamanivalu, Jack Goodhue, Richie Mo'unga and Sam Whitelock will feature for the Crusaders.
